Description

Indulge in Caribbean-inspired flavors at our York restaurant all day long! From our signature smoky jerk dishes to our specialty rum and 2-4-1 cocktails during Happy Hour, there's something for everyone. Join us for dinner or our iconic Bottomless Brunch, where you can sip on tropical cocktails from our island bar. Whether it's a date night, dinner with friends, or a special celebration, Turtle Bay guarantees a good time with rum flowing and the best vibes around. My husband and I stopped at this restaurant for brunch and we were both very pleased with our meals. He had the vegan burger and I had the vegan bowl, both of which were amazing.

We popped in for a couple of 2-4-1 Mojitos on the Saturday before Christmas upon noticing the menu outside indicated all drinks (including cocktails) and food are clearly labelled as vegan (VE). This is essentially a Caribbean version of Las Iguanas. Very modern, artificially themed and vibrantly decorated . However, they do acknowledge that vegans exist in society.

This restaurant offers a basic burger meal with limited variety in options. The cocktails are labeled as either vegan or non-vegan. We were served meat by mistake, but thankfully caught it before eating. It's a reminder to always be cautious when dining out. (Updated from a previous review on January 24, 2023)

The restaurant offers a good variety of vegan options, even on the limited menu, and all of the food was tasty. However, we felt rushed because our food came out so quickly, and it seemed like they were trying to seat more customers. Unfortunately, they had run out of one of the two vegan desserts. On a positive note, all drinks, including cocktails, are clearly labeled as either vegan or non-vegan.

I wanted something light, had the vegan Trini doubles and some sweet potato fries, it was so yummy and you can sit outside with the dog while still hearing the reggae music!
